Ben Griffin

Ben Griffin brings over 30 years of fire safety experience and a career long passion for Life Safety Systems and the people they protect to Capitol Sprinkler and Fire Systems. Early on, Mr. Griffin began his career in fabrication and installation. He quickly moved up into project management working as Foreman and Superintendent managing teams of 50+ workers at a time. Mr. Griffin’s extensive hands on experience working with general contractors in Texas and all over the United States enabled him to transition into Sales providing clients with accurate project cost estimations, budgeting, custom design, and start-to-finish project management. Hewlett Packard Data Centers and Universal Studios are among Mr. Griffin’s sizable list of large scale projects he initiated over the course of his career.

Mr. Griffin continues his work in the Fire Safety industry as the Owner and Managing Partner overseeing Sales and Project Management for Capitol Sprinkler and Fire Systems. James Puckett

Mr. Puckett started his career in the fire protection industry in 2010 following his honorable service in the United States Marine Corps. He started as an apprentice in the fire alarm side and was determined to know and understand all aspects of the fire protection industry. Since the start of his career he has obtained all certifications in the field which includes his Fire alarm License (FAL), Fire Sprinkler Inspector License (RME-I), Backflow (BPAT) certification, Hydrant certification and obtained his Class A Extinguishing Systems license (FEL-A). His FEL-A includes Portable, Kitchen Hood and Fire Suppression extinguishing systems.

James Puckett is well verse in all types and brands of fire systems from installing, service and inspecting. He has installed, service and managed small to large projects across Texas state wide. He continues his career by advancing through his NICET certifications and attending seminars to keep himself up to date with new local, state and national codes. Mr. Puckett joined Capitol Sprinkler and Fire Systems as the Fire Alarm Operations Manager. He currently oversees all personnel and projects that are involved with Fire Alarm, Inspections and Special Hazards.
